Elsewhere in the Metro today, and not on their web site, is an interview with Alison Barshak of Alison at Blue Bell. Alison was the original chef at Striped Bass and now splits time between New York and her restaurant in the Philadelphia suburbs.
Alison reveals her favorite Philadelphia restaurants are Vetri, Dmitri’s for the octopus and Plymouth Meeting’s Blue Fin for sushi.
She feels it’s easier to be a chef/owner in Philadelphia than New York and that Philadelphia has great young chefs that aren’t afraid to grow and experiment.
Alison’s just gotten back from South Carolina and the Grit Festival. So expect to see black truffle grits with halibut on her menu.
